Sat 1418405747850363

decimal
357362.747850363
degree
0°147362′530″747850363‴
percentile
67.54313092431477%
name
dumwuzvprfq
cycle
0
epoch
1
period
177
block
357362
offset
747850363
timestamp
rarity
common